Present in 96 countries, we are dedicated to changing the way the world uses energy through advanced electric vehicle charging and energy management systems. Our headquarters are in Barcelona, and we have manufacturing facilities in Spain (Barcelona) and the US (Arlington, Texas). We are rapidly becoming a leading company in the market.

In 2021, we were listed on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E WBX), allowing us to garner acclaim and win prestigious design awards (the IF Design, Good Design, and RedDot Awards).

In 2022, we acquired ARES (an assembly electronics company) and COIL (Installers of turnkey EV charging solutions). One year later, in 2023, we acquired ABL, the leading German EV charger manufacturer, which has allowed us to have a stronger presence in Europe.
